There’s a reason this bull market seems so weird

We’re now more than a year away from the October 2022 bear market low, and even though the bull market isn’t exactly raging, stocks are still up more than 20%.

Markets, however, do not behave as they usually do at the start of long-running bull markets. In some ways, the past year feels more like the end of a year than the beginning. This makes me worry that this won’t last.
